JOB SUMMARYThe Head of Compliance provides enterprise-wide strategic leadership and oversight of CRC Group’s regulatory and corporate compliance policies, procedures and programs including compliance operations. The Head of Compliance is accountable for defining and integrating compliance strategy across CRC Group, ensuring that CRC’s Compliance function is best in class. Reporting to the General Counsel, this role serves as the organization’s recognized compliance authority and partners directly with senior leadership across all corporate functions and all business segments.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
- Set the strategic direction for CRC’s enterprise compliance function, developing and implementing compliance frameworks, policies, and standards aligned with evolving regulatory requirements across all functions and business segments in all jurisdictions in which it operates.
- Leads Compliance operations including but not limited to licensing, surplus lines, financial crimes, quality assurance, market security, and agency appointments.
- Partner with executive leadership and the General Counsel to identify, assess, and mitigate enterprise compliance risks; provide executive-level reporting on compliance performance, exposure areas, regulatory developments, and corrective actions.
- Develop, maintain, and continually improve enterprise-wide compliance monitoring and audit programs; oversee compliance risk assessments and ensure timely, practical remediation of identified gaps.
- Ensure CRC’s operations comply with all applicable regulatory requirements, including but not limited to insurance-specific state and federal regulatory obligations.
- Maintain strong relationships with regulatory agencies and industry groups.
- Lead the development and implementation of compliance-driven operational policies and procedures across all regions and business units; ensure consistent application of standards through direct and matrix compliance leadership.
- Champion a culture of ethical business conduct, accountability, and proactive compliance across CRC Group; serve as a visible internal and external advocate for compliance excellence.
- Lead, develop, and build a pipeline of compliance talent across multiple teams and sub-functions; establish clear accountability structures, development plans, and succession pathways within the compliance organization.
- Develop and implement training, policy review, policy and procedures to address and mitigate errors & omissions risk exposure.
- Contribute to CRC Group’s strategic planning process as a member of the Legal, Risk & Compliance leadership team; serve on relevant external panels, industry working groups, and regulatory forums to raise CRC’s profile and bring market intelligence back into the organization.

CRC Group is one of the largest wholesale insurance distributors in the U.S. CRC Group consists of three divisions, Commercial Solutions, Group & Individual Solutions, and Specialty Programs. The CRC Group family of brands includes CRC, TAPCO, Insurisk, CRC Programs, 5Star, The ABC Program, Negley, Professional Insurance Concepts, Pro-Praxis, SHU, Target, JH Blades, CRC Voluntary Benefits, Ethos Underwriting Services, and Hanleigh. CRC Group’s insurance offerings and practice groups range from commercial property, casualty, professional lines, small business, transportation, environmental, construction, energy, healthcare, hospitality, manufacturing & distribution, public entity, and real estate, to personal lines, disability, voluntary benefits, and more.
